My Happy Marriage (Season 1), Episode 3 “Our First Date” Recap:
The episode begins with Kiyoko enjoying the meal prepared by Miyo. Kiyoko asks her to join him as he goes to town. Miyo tells him she would burden him and has no reason to go to town. Kiyoko insists that she will not be a nuisance and asks her to wear the kimono she wore the day she arrived. Miyo hesitantly agrees. Even without saying it out loud, the day and date of their first date are set. Miyo prepares for the date by combing her hair with her mother’s broken comb. Yurie informs her that they have installed a mirror just for her, which she can use. Yurie asks Miyo if she wants to help with her makeup, and Miyo responds by saying that she had never used makeup before. Yurie is excited and tells her that she will help her with it. Miyo is upset because she has no makeup, but Yurie solves the problem by providing basic makeup.
Yurie helps Miyo with makeup, and once she is done, she is thrilled to see how beautiful Miyo looks. Kiyoko calls out from outside to check if she is ready. Miyo runs out so as not to keep him waiting. Kiyoko’s eyes sparkle, seeing Miyo’s transformation. They leave for their date. Kiyoko informs Miyo that they would stop by his workplace first as parking is a hassle, and she does not need to feel concerned. At his workplace, they bump into Kiyoko’s co-worker, Godo. Godo gets curious about Miyo and tries to get more information about her identity. Kiyoko informs him that she was escorting him that day and that he needs to stop prying and return to his post. After he leaves, Kiyoko tells Miyo that he is gifted with supernatural skills more than he would like to admit.
They visit the town, and Kiyoko asks her if she wants to buy or needs something, but Miyo cannot think of anything. Kiyoko thinks for a bit and asks her to accompany him to run some shopping errands. Miyo is fascinated by everything she sees. Kiyoko asks her if she is having fun, and Miyo starts apologizing. Kiyoko lovingly pats her head and tells her to enjoy the day to her heart’s content, and nobody would scold her. He also tells her not to think of her as a nuisance as he wants her there. He advises her not to get lost while exploring, and Miyo tells him she will be careful. Miyo wonders why people would call him cruel when he was so kind.
Mr. Tatsuishi is speaking with Shinji about Miyo being married off to the Kudo family. Shinji tells him he has abandoned Miyo and does not care about her well-being. However, he assures Tatsuishi that Kiyoko will lose interest in Miyo when he discovers she has no supernatural abilities. He was free to take her when she was abandoned. Tatsuishi wonders why he would abandon Miyo when her offspring can be gifted. Kaya asks the maid what her father is talking about, and she tells her that it is about Miyo. Kaya loses her temper, but Koji asks her not to raise her voice and, to ease her anger, offers to take her shopping. Hesitantly, Kaya agrees but thinks that Koji still has feelings for Miyo.
Kiyoko takes Miyo to a prestigious Kimono store. The lady in the store informs him that everything is ready as per his request. They sit to chat, and the lady teases Kiyoko that his time is finally here as he has never brought a woman to the store. Kiyoko thinks about the conversation between Yurie and him. Yurie had informed Kiyoko that Miyo would sew her own kimono, and Kiyoko had realized that she just had one good kimono. He tells himself that she would own many more if she were properly cared for.
Kiyoko chooses a cherry blossom-colored material to get a Kimono stitched for Miyo. The lady in the store advises him to hold on to her no matter what happens, as she is like a gemstone that needs polishing to shine. She tells her that buying her a kimono is only the beginning, and he needs to shower her with love and wealth. Kiyoko watches Miyo look at a cherry-colored kimono and says, “I miss you.” Kiyoko is confused. Kiyoko takes her to eat, but he discovers she does not like the food. He wonders out loud what she would look like when she smiles.
Kiyoko informs Miyo that the next step in their relationship is marriage, and he wants her to be open and honest rather than always apologizing. Miyo is worried as she realizes that he does not know that she does not possess any supernatural abilities, but she feels she needs to be by his side for a long time. Kiyoko leaves a box that contains a comb in front of Miyo’s door. Miyo loves the comb and rushes to Kiyoko and tells him that it looks expensive, and she cannot accept it. But Kiyoko tells her that it is a gift. Kiyoko recalls Yurie’s words saying Miyo always used a broken comb, and his gesture would mean a lot to her. She gave her approval for his relationship with Miyo. Kiyoko asks Miyo to use it freely and looks at her to find her blushing and smiling.
My Happy Marriage (Season 1), Episode 3 “Our First Date” Ending, Explained:
The episode ends with Kiyoko discovering that Miyo does not possess supernatural abilities. He also realizes how Miyo has been treated all her life, and buying her a few possessions cannot heal her. He also learns that her birth mother was a relative of the Usuba clan. Kiyoko walks out of his office, thinking that he has been going home early since Miyo’s arrival when Shiki-gami attacked him. Kiyoko wonders who was brave enough to send these to spy on him.
In this episode, we see Kiyoko’s kind-hearted, caring, and loving side. He is anything but the reputation he had. Miyo felt loved and cared for like never before. Without knowing the whole truth, Kiyoko had already started treating Miyo well; now that he knows about her family situation, how he looks at Miyo will be much more loving. In the end, the Shiki-game was probably sent by Mr. Tatsuishi to know how Miyo was doing so they could swoop in and take her away from him. Kiyoko needs to be more careful now and protect himself and Miyo.
